Electrical Project Manager

Recognized as one of the more experienced contractors in the commercial public works sector in the state of Washington, D&S, a leading electrical contractor, is searching for the right candidate to join its team as a Project Manager. This individual is responsible for planning, executing, and evaluating projects according to schedules and budgets. Also vital to this position is helping to build and manage the project team, ensuring quality control, safety policy adherence and client satisfaction, and communicating effectively and proactively to the Project Executive, client, subcontractors, and our vendor partners throughout the life of the Project.This position is based in our office in Kent, WA but will most likely be mobile out on project sites. 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Procure work and develop clientele.
  • Manage project development from initiation to closure.
  • Be accountable for project results.
  • Work with all members of the project team to complete project outlining scope, goals, deliverables, required resources, budget, and timing.
  • Clearly communicate expectations to the project team.
  • Facilitate communications between design, owner and the project team.
  • Resolve issues and solve problems throughout the life of the project.
  • Effectively manage project by ensuring any changes to scope are tracked and approved with the proper documentation per the project contract.

Desired Skills and Experience

  • Experience in electrical project management required.
  • Degree in Construction Management or Electrical Engineering preferred.
  • Solid knowledge of construction cost, scheduling, estimating and engineering principals and techniques, as well as accounting principles.
  • Knowledge of LEAN principles including the Last Planner System is preferred.
  • Must be capable of electrical estimating in order to produce job change orders, evaluate and apply job estimates and assist with new estimates as required.
  • Must be proficient with project management tools and software packages. Experience with Accubid Estimating systems, Procore and Bluebeam Revu is preferred.
  • Knowledge of and experience with integrated job cost systems to budget, evaluate reports and project final costing.
  • Knowledge of and experience with building critical path schedules for projects.
  • Knowledge of and experience with design-build delivery models is strongly preferred.
  • Experience with identification and quantification of project impacts is preferred.
